Procurement Commodity Leader - Facility ManagementDate: 7 Oct 2024Company: Alstom At Alstom, we understand transport networks and what moves people. From high-speed trains, metros, monorails, and trams, to turnkey systems, services, infrastructure, signalling and digital mobility, we offer our diverse customers the broadest portfolio in the industry. Every day, more than 80 000 colleagues lead the way to greener and smarter mobility worldwide, connecting cities as we reduce carbon and replace cars.Could you be the full-time Procurement Commodity Leader – Facility Management we’re looking for?This position is located in St. Ouen (France).Your future roleTake on a new challenge and apply your strategic procurement expertise in a new cutting-edge field. You’ll report to Royce MOEHRENSCHLAGER (Commodity Manager for Facility Management in Berlin) and work alongside dedicated Commodity Leaders and Regional Buyers worldwide.You'll be in charge of deploying the Integrated Facility Management concept in countries all over the world, following our procurement strategy. Day-to-day, you’ll work closely with teams across the business (Regional Procurement, project, Legal, Supplier risk, Quality, Finance, Real Estate, and Industrial teams), to support the group’s industrial strategy through supplier excellence.You’ll specifically take care of the global suppliers relationship management, but also support RFQ process and supplier negotiation.We’ll look to you for:Leading the commodityEnhancing Supplier relationshipLeading the commodityAcquire knowledge of global market, organize benchmarks, apply cost modelsAct as an expert with optimization of product total cost of OwnershipSupport actively transversal and sites projects executionManage supplier risks and set appropriate mitigation planLead commodity maturity improvement plan and the savings planTake appropriate trainings providedLive the ALSTOM Way of WorkingDevelop commodity strategy with all stakeholders and drive its implementationDefine supplier target panel in-line with Procurement strategyLead the supplier selection processEnhance Supplier relationshipManage global supplier panel relationship especially on contractualizationManage global supplier Quality Cost Delivery & Technical (QCDT) objectives and performancePerform regular business reviews and supplier performance reviews, solve major issuesDrive supplier complex negotiations as appropriateSupport monitoring of Corporate Social Responsibility engagements and deviationsPromote the Alstom Code of Ethics and adhering to the highest standards of ethical conduct.All about youWe value passion and attitude over experience. That’s why we don’t expect you to have every single skill. Instead, we’ve listed some that we think will help you succeed and grow in this role:Engineering or Business School master degree, with specialization in PurchasingExperience in procurement (5 to 10 years) including category managementExperience in multicultural teams (minimum 5 years)Knowledge of Facility ManagementFinance &/or CAPEX background would be a plusAbility to work in a matrix environmentAbility to challengeResults orientedInternal and external influencing skillsNegotiation and strategic visionFluent in English with international mindsetThings you’ll enjoyJoin us on a life-long transformative journey – the rail industry is here to stay, so you can grow and develop new skills and experiences throughout your career.
